Obesity is a serious public health problem in the United States. It is important to estimate obesity prevalence at the local level to target programmatic and policy interventions. It is challenging, however, to obtain local estimates of obesity prevalence because national health surveys such as the Centers for Disease Control and Prevention (CDC) Behavioral Risk Factor Surveillance System (BRFSS) are not designed to produce direct estimates at the local levels (e.g. census tracts) due to small population samples and the need to preserve individual confidentiality. In this study we address the problem of estimating local obesity prevalence rates by implementing a spatial microsimulation modeling technique to proportionally replicate the demographic characteristics of BRFSS respondents to census tract populations in metropolitan Detroit. Obesity prevalence rates are examined for high and low spatial clusters and studied in relation to the U.S. Department of Agriculture's (USDA) measures of low-income neighborhoods and local food deserts and CDC's measure of healthy and less healthy food environments currently used to target obesity reduction initiatives. This study found that obesity prevalence was largely clustered in the City of Detroit extending north into contiguous suburbs. The spatial patterns of highest obesity prevalence tracts were most similarly aligned with USDA-defined low-income tracts and CDC's less healthy food tracts. The locations of USDA's food desert tracts rarely overlapped with the highest obesity prevalence tracts. This study demonstrated a new methodology by which to assess local areas in need of future obesity interventions.  相似文献

Objectives

We examined whether and to what extent the relationship between township disadvantages and obesity varied across geographical areas.

Methods

A cross-sectional analysis of a population-based sample of Taiwanese adults (N = 25,985) from the 2005 Social Development Trend Survey on Health and Safety was performed. Multilevel models integrated with geographically weighted regressions were employed to analyze the spatially varying association between area disadvantages and obesity. The dependent variable was body mass index calculated from respondents’ self-reported weight and height. The key explanatory variable was a township disadvantage index made of poverty level, minority composition, and social disorder. Other individual socio-demographic characteristics were included to account for the compositional effect.

Results

The association between township disadvantages and elevated obesity risk in Taiwan was found to be area-specific. In contrast to results from the commonly used global regression, geographically weighted regression model showed that township disadvantages elevated obesity level only in certain areas.

Conclusions

We found heterogeneity of place-level determinants of obesity across geographical areas. Adoption of population approach to curb obesity would require area-specific strategies for most needed areas.  相似文献

The inclusion of obesity within public health rests on a proven and accepted biomedical link between body weight and health status. Drawing on the 2005 controversy over annual death rates attributable to obesity in the US, this paper contends that uncertainty as to the causal mechanisms linking body weight and health are undermining the development of effective obesity prevention policies. Consequently, this also weakens the justification of the inclusion of such policies within public health. This work draws on recent interest in ‘critical geographies of public health’ and the continued attention to the recursive relations between people and places in the context of health which may offer a useful theoretical viewpoint from which unpack such aetiological uncertainty. Without an agreed or universal risk from obesity, the paper argues that public health obesity prevention through social marketing should be geographical in outlook. The three examples of 5 a day, Jamie’s School Dinners and Sesame Street’s Cookie Monster are discussed to illustrate the effectiveness of communicating risk in a manner that allows intention to be effectively translated into risk-minimising behaviour within the dictates of locale.  相似文献

Based on the data from the Behavioral Risk Factor Surveillance System (BRFSS) in 2007, 2009 and 2011 in Utah, this research uses multilevel modeling (MLM) to examine the associations between neighborhood built environments and individual odds of overweight and obesity after controlling for individual risk factors. The BRFSS data include information on 21,961 individuals geocoded to zip code areas. Individual variables include BMI (body mass index) and socio-demographic attributes such as age, gender, race, marital status, education attainment, employment status, and whether an individual smokes. Neighborhood built environment factors measured at both zip code and county levels include street connectivity, walk score, distance to parks, and food environment. Two additional neighborhood variables, namely the poverty rate and urbanicity, are also included as control variables. MLM results show that at the zip code level, poverty rate and distance to parks are significant and negative covariates of the odds of overweight and obesity; and at the county level, food environment is the sole significant factor with stronger fast food presence linked to higher odds of overweight and obesity. These findings suggest that obesity risk factors lie in multiple neighborhood levels and built environment features need to be defined at a neighborhood size relevant to residents' activity space.  相似文献

Street connectivity, defined as the number of (3-way or more) intersections per area unit, is an important index of built environments as a proxy for walkability in a neighborhood. This paper examines its geographic variations across the rural-urban continuum (urbanicity), major racial-ethnic groups and various poverty levels. The population-adjusted street connectivity index is proposed as a better measure than the regular index for a large area such as county due to likely concentration of population in limited space within the large area. Based on the data from the Behavioral Risk Factor Surveillance System (BRFSS), this paper uses multilevel modeling to analyze its association with physical activity and obesity while controlling for various individual- and county-level variables. Analysis of data subsets indicates that the influences of individual and county-level variables on obesity risk vary across areas of different urbanization levels. The positive influence of street connectivity on obesity control is limited to the more but not the mostly urbanized areas. This demonstrates the value of obesogenic environment research in different geographic settings, helps us reconcile and synthesize some seemingly contradictory results reported in different studies, and also promotes that effective policies need to be highly sensitive to the diversity of demographic groups and geographically adaptable.  相似文献

目的 探讨肥胖患者上气道结构的多层螺旋CT(MSCT)形态学改变,以揭示肥胖患者上气道结构异常及其与阻塞性睡眠呼吸暂停综合征(OSAHS)病情严重程度的关系。方法 选择经多导睡眠监测(PSG)确诊的非OSAHS和OSAHS肥胖患者各25例,对所有入组患者进行额窦层面至第7颈椎水平多层螺旋CT扫描及三维重建,测量鼻咽、腭咽、口咽和喉咽的最小截面积及其周围组织并进行比较。并且分析4个平面测量指标与体重指数(BMI)、颈围、睡眠呼吸暂停低通气指数(AHI)等指标的相关性。结果 与非OSAHS组患者比较,OSAHS组肥胖患者软腭的面积明显增大(P<0.05),其体积增大更加明显(P<0.01);口咽部气道的截面积、前后径、体积,均比非OSAHS组患者明显减小(P均<0.05),并且软腭的体积均与BMI、AHI呈正相关(P均<0.01)。结论 MSCT能从二维及三维结构评估肥胖患者上气道阻塞及周围软组织情况,并且提示软腭体积增大可能与OSAHS严重程度相关。  相似文献

This article interrogates how social media can provide a platform for contesting dominant discourses. It does so through the lens of competitive eating, demonstrating that amateur competitive eaters use social media sites to challenge and subvert mass media representations of their sport while concomitantly upholding normative notions of healthy eating and bodies. Competitors consider themselves to be skilful athletes that discipline and train their bodies to eat. They regard their eating practices, which are often depicted in the mass media as uncontrolled and gluttonous, as controlled ingestion, and present an alternative perspective of their ‘sport’ – a perspective that stresses health, physical expertise and a fit, trained body over voracity and insatiability. Social media acts as a ‘precipitating agency’ for the creation of these alternative definitions of disciplined eating, as well as the construction of new digital eating identities. Instead of focusing on the food being ingested and the ‘Carnivalesque’ practice of competitive eating, we draw attention to the performers’ voices and the ways they attend to the mechanics of gurgitation, including methods of chewing, swallowing and stomach stretching, and their ability to manage, regulate and operate ingestivity. As hegemonic discourses align the notion of ‘good eating’ to discipline, order and restraint, competitive eating is thus revealed to be a practice that mirrors and appropriates, yet also ultimately reproduces, conventional narratives. Social media is, in turn, shown to be a political tool for counter-discursive practices that are produced in dialogue with, and concomitantly uphold and contest, normative discourses of mass media.  相似文献
